what is (3xy^2)(-6xy^4)

Respuesta :

calculista
calculista calculista
  • 11-02-2020

Answer:

[tex]-18x^2y^6[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

we have

[tex](3xy^2)(-6xy^4)[/tex]

Applying property of exponents

[tex]x^{m} x^{n}=x^{m+n}[/tex]

[tex](3xy^2)(-6xy^4)=(3)(-6)(x^{1+1})(y^{2+4})=(-18)(x^{2})(y^{6})=-18x^2y^6[/tex]
